TECHNICAL FIELD
[0001] The present application relates to the technical field of dust cleaner support, in particular to a foldable dust cleaner support. BACKGROUND
[0002] The dust cleaner support is a device for storing and fixing the dust cleaner, which can help users effectively manage the dust cleaner, so that it does not occupy too much space and is convenient to use. In addition, in actual use, some dust cleaner supports are also equipped with hooks or hooks, which are convenient for users to hang accessories such as suction pipes and brush heads, so that the entire cleaning tool is more orderly, which not only saves space, but also makes the cleaning tool more orderly and convenient to use. In short, as a small household appliance accessory in daily life, the dust cleaner support plays an important role in effectively managing and utilizing space, and with the progress of science and technology and the improvement of people's requirements for life quality, its function and design are constantly innovating and improving.
[0003] In the existing Chinese patents, the patent with the publication number CN210749006U discloses a buckle type dust cleaner support, which comprises a base, a buckle body and a support body. The support body is a hollow tubular structure, one end of the support body is provided with a clamping hole, the buckle body is elastically connected with a top cap used in cooperation with the clamping hole, the top cap protrudes out of the buckle body and is used to protrude into the clamping hole, and the end of the support body away from the clamping hole is provided with a clamping piece for fixing the dust cleaner outside;
[0004] The support part of the patent is arranged at 90 degrees with the base, and the center of gravity is high, so that when the dust cleaner is supported, the stability is not high, and the dust cleaner is easy to fall over. And the patent is difficult to fold, so that when the dust cleaner support is transported or stored, a large space is needed, so we propose a foldable dust cleaner support to solve the above technical problems. DETAILED DESCRIPTION
[0031] Referring to Figures 1 to 6 :
[0032] The present application provides a folding vacuum cleaner support, comprising a base 1 and a support frame body 4, the left end of the base 1 is provided with a blocking frame 2 for limiting the vacuum cleaner floor brush 14, the right end of the base 1 is provided with at least two support plates 3, and the two support plates 3 are respectively fixedly installed on the front and rear sides of the base 1, the support frame body 4 is located above the right end of the base 1 and extends upwardly and obliquely towards the blocking frame 2, and the two support plates 3 are located at the bottom of the inner side of the support frame body 4;
[0033] The blocking frame 2 is provided with at least two, and the two blocking frames 2 are distributed in front of and behind each other, the top of the support frame body 4 is provided with an inner recess 401 for supporting the main stem 13 of the vacuum cleaner, the spacing between the front and rear blocking frames 2 is greater than the front and rear width of the upper end of the support frame body 4, and the inner side of the support frame body 4 is provided with a shelf 403;
[0034] As Figure 6 shown, when the vacuum cleaner support is used to support the vacuum cleaner, the vacuum cleaner floor brush 14 is placed on the upper surface of the base 1, at the same time, the two blocking frames 2 block and limit the left side of the vacuum cleaner floor brush 14, and the main stem 13 of the vacuum cleaner is clamped into the inner recess 401 of the support frame body 4;
[0035] Therefore, when the vacuum cleaner is supported, the support frame body 4, the vacuum cleaner and the base 1 can form a triangular structure, so that the vacuum cleaner is placed more stably and is not easy to fall down, at the same time, the obliquely arranged support frame body 4 can reduce the center of gravity of the vacuum cleaner support, so that the vacuum cleaner support is not easy to fall down when it is erected, and the shelf 403 on the support frame body 4 can place the suction pipe, brush head and other accessories of the vacuum cleaner.
[0036] According to the above, the front and rear sides of the support frame body 4 are inserted with support bolts 5 between the same side support plates 3, the part of the support frame body 4 below the support bolts 5 is provided as a matching part 402, both support plates 3 are provided with a through slot 301 on the right side of the matching part 402, a limiting rod 7 for limiting the matching part 402 is inserted between the two through slots 301, the front and rear ends of the limiting rod 7 penetrate the same side through slot 301, and the part of the limiting rod 7 penetrating the through slot 301 is provided as a second limiting part 701, both support plates 3 are inserted with a limiting bolt 6 on the left side of the matching part 402, and a spring 8 is installed between the front and rear ends of the limiting rod 7 and the same side support bolt 5;
[0037] The support bolt 5 is rotatably connected with the support frame body 4, the part of the support bolt 5 penetrating into the inside of the support plate 3 is sleeved with a first nut 501 and a second nut 502, one end of the spring 8 is sleeved on the support bolt 5 and located between the first nut 501 and the second nut 502, and the other end of the spring 8 is sleeved on the outside of the limiting rod 7, the through slot 301 is vertically arranged, and the limiting rod 7 is slidably connected with the through slot 301, the front and rear ends of the limiting rod 7 are inserted with a pin 9 on the inside of the support plate 3, when the limiting rod 7 is located at the bottom of the through slot 301, the second limiting part 701 is located below the matching part 402, the front and rear ends of the limiting bolt 6 penetrate the support plate 3, and the part of the limiting bolt 6 outside the support plate 3 is provided as a first limiting part 601, and the first limiting part 601 is located on the left side of the matching part 402;
[0038] The limiting rod 7 can slide up and down in the through slot 301, the spring 8 has a contraction force in the stretched state, so that in the state that the limiting rod 7 is not pushed by external force, the spring 8 pulls the limiting rod 7 to the top of the through slot 301 by the elastic force and stays at the current position, and the pins 9 at the front and rear ends can limit the front and rear ends of the limiting rod 7, so that the limiting rod 7 cannot move greatly in the front and rear directions;
[0039] The support frame body 4 can be flipped left and right through the rotational connection with the support bolt 5, but through the cooperation of the first limiting part 601 and the second limiting part 701, the left and right sides of the matching part 402 can be limited respectively, so that the support frame body 4 cannot be flipped left and right after being erected;
[0040] If the support frame body 4 needs to be flipped and folded, an external force is applied to push the limiting rod 7 to slide down to the bottom of the through slot 301, and at this time the second limiting part 701 is located below the right side of the matching part 402, so that the second limiting part 701 is separated from the limiting of the right side of the matching part 402, and then the support frame body 4 can be flipped to the left to a horizontal state and abut against the base 1, and the upper end of the support frame body 4 is placed between the two blocking frames 2, such as Figure 5As shown, in this way, the dust cleaner support can be folded to reduce the packaging and transportation volume or storage space of the dust cleaner support.
[0041] When the folded dust cleaner support is used, the limiting rod 7 is pushed to slide to the bottom of the through slot 301 in the same way, and then the support frame body 4 is pushed to overturn to the right. When the support frame body 4 is overturned, if the left side surface of the matching part 402 is in contact with the first limiting part 601, the external force applied to the limiting rod 7 can be removed. Then, the spring 8 pulls the limiting rod 7 to slide to the top of the through slot 301 by the elastic force. The second limiting part 701 limits the right side of the matching part 402, so that the support frame body 4 remains in the upright state. In this way, when the dust cleaner support is used, the support frame body 4 can be directly overturned upward and used in the upright state, which is convenient and quick and saves the complicated installation process.
[0042] In summary:
[0043] Through the rotational connection of the support frame body 4 and the support plate 3, when the support frame body 4 is upright, the first limiting part 601 and the second limiting part 701 can limit the rotation of the support frame body 4, so that the support frame body 4 always remains in the upright state. When folding is required, the limiting rod 7 is moved downward, and then the second limiting part 701 loses the limitation of the support frame body 4. Then, the support frame body 4 can be rotated and folded together with the base 1. In this way, the support frame body 4 can be folded to reduce the packaging and transportation volume or storage space of the support frame body 4. In addition, when the dust cleaner support is used, the support frame body 4 can be directly overturned upward and used in the upright state, which is convenient and quick and saves the complicated installation process.
[0044] By tilting the support frame body 4, when the dust cleaner is supported, the support frame body 4, the dust cleaner and the base 1 can form a triangular structure, so that the dust cleaner is placed more stably and is not easy to fall. The tilting of the support frame body 4 can lower the center of gravity of the dust cleaner support, so that the dust cleaner support is not easy to fall when it is upright.
[0045] In another embodiment, as shown in Figures 7 to 9 :
[0046] Two support plates 3 are replaced by two inclined plates 10, the inclined plates 10 are rotatably connected with the support frame body 4, and the inclination of the inclined plates 10 is consistent with the inclination of the support frame body 4, the outer side surface of the inclined plates 10 is provided with a semispherical protruding part 11, and the front and back sides of the lower end of the support frame body 4 are provided with circular holes 12 matched with the protruding part 11; thus, when the dust collector support is used, after the support frame body 4 is erected upward, the protruding part 11 will slide into the circular hole 12 and be clamped with the circular hole 12, so as to fix the support frame body 4, conversely, the support frame body 4 is pushed downward and turned over, then the protruding part 11 will slide out of the circular hole 12, at this time, the dust collector support can be folded.
